Git And Hashing Helpers¶
Module: thornforge.buildsite.git
Overview¶
This module wraps Git subprocess calls, exports tagged refs, clones remote repositories, copies local worktrees, and computes the content digests used to deduplicate documentation builds.
Autodoc¶
Git and hashing helpers used to materialize and deduplicate docs builds.
These helpers isolate direct Git process calls and the content hashing logic used to decide whether multiple versions can reuse the same canonical build.

- thornforge.buildsite.git.hash_version_inputs(repo_root: Path, tag: str, input_paths: tuple[str, ...]) str¶
Build a stable cache key for a tagged repository version.
- Parameters:
repo_root – Git repository root from which tree objects are read.
tag – Git reference naming the version to hash.
input_paths – Repository-relative paths that should contribute to the build key, typically docs sources and metadata files.
- Returns:
A short hexadecimal digest string used as the canonical build directory name for this version.
Notes
The hash includes both repository content and ThornForge-owned assets so rebuilt output changes when the shared UI assets change.

- thornforge.buildsite.git.update_asset_digest(digest: hashlib._Hash) None¶
Mix ThornForge-owned asset files into an existing digest object.
- Parameters:
digest – Mutable hash object that already contains repository-specific content.
- Side Effects:
Reads shared CSS, JavaScript, and template asset files and appends their paths and contents into
digest.
- Returns:
None. The supplied digest object is updated in place.
